Job description

Well, hello there

Castify (Creators of Screencastify) is a leading technology company dedicated to improving communication and learning outcomes with video. We have established ourselves as a leader in the K-12 education sector in the United States and we are critical in helping scale a teacher and improve student outcomes. We are also actively expanding into new and exciting markets outside of K-12 including bringing our tested solution into companies and organizations. Castify is used by over 15M people today and is seeking a VP of Engineering to join our Squad!

About this role

What started as the simplest and most reliable screen recorder in the world, with millions of users, is now a multi-product, AI-first platform. Our near future is full of ambitious new goals, features, and products that will enable us to further improve how we provide service to our users and accelerate growth.

We prioritize fast iteration without compromising quality while maintaining attention to detail that creates the kind of seamless, high-quality experiences we’re known for. We’re looking for an experienced, strategic VP of Engineering to lead and scale our engineering organization as we continue building innovative products that impact millions of users worldwide.

This role will partner with Product and GTM teams to define and execute our technical vision, strengthen engineering operations, and help shape the future of video communication and AI-powered learning experiences.

What you’ll do:
  • Lead a high-performing Engineering organization across multiple product areas and platforms.
  • Champion the adoption of AI-powered engineering tools and workflows to accelerate team velocity and output quality.
  • Partner with Product leadership to define technical strategy, roadmap priorities, and execution plans.
  • Drive engineering excellence by establishing scalable systems, development standards, and operational best practices.
  • Oversee the architecture, development, testing, deployment, and reliability of our products and infrastructure.
  • Shape and evolve our AI-first product strategy by enabling experimentation, rapid iteration, and scalable implementation.
  • Guide technical decision-making across frontend, backend, infrastructure, data, and platform initiatives.
  • Ensure strong execution across teams by removing blockers, clarifying priorities, and aligning engineering efforts to business outcomes.
  • Foster a strong engineering culture grounded in ownership, accountability, and continuous improvement.
You’re perfect for this role if you:
  • Bring 12+ years of software engineering experience leading teams in high-growth SaaS or product-led technology companies.
  • Have worked in early-stage or growth-stage startups (fewer than 50 people) and thrive in environments that require ownership and an entrepreneurial mindset.
  • Are a hands‑on technical leader who stays close to the work, comfortable diving into architecture and code‑level discussions to guide decisions and solve technical problems.
  • Are fluent in how AI is changing the software engineering craft — you've personally used AI coding tools and have driven adoption of AI‑assisted workflows across a team
  • Have a strong foundation across modern web technologies, cloud infrastructure, distributed systems, and scalable architectures, with experience in end-to-end systems (frontend, backend, platform, infrastructure, and DevOps) using tools like TypeScript, React, Node.js, and GCP.
  • Possess a track record of building and scaling products used by millions of users, with deep expertise in system design, reliability, scalability, and security.
  • Can translate company strategy into clear technical direction and drive strong execution in a fast‑moving, high‑accountability environment.
  • Communicate effectively across all levels from engineers to executives balancing technical depth with clear, outcome‑oriented storytelling.
  • Excel in ambiguity, moving quickly and decisively without sacrificing engineering quality.

This is a Chicago‑based position with 3 days a week in the office.
